Landry, Wilfred Alexander, age 99, of Highland Crest Home,
Antigonish, and formerly of Havre Boucher, passed away on November 3,
2021, in St. Martha’s Regional Hospital,
Antigonish.
Born in Havre Boucher, he was a son of the late Wallace and
Elizabeth (Fougere) Landry.
Wilfred was a hardworking man. He cut kindling
until he was 97 years old. He worked in The States for a
time and worked on the freight boats, but for the most part, he was a
farmer. He was known for his vegetable garden and sold
vegetables door-to-door in the Auld’s Cove/Port Hawkesbury
area for 62 years. A generous man, he loved to have fun (including a
good drink) and animals (especially his horses). Wilfred was also very
dedicated to his church, never missing Mass, and he had an amazing
ability to find the good in everyone he met.
